The Role of the Thermostat in Heating And Cooling Effectiveness





Although usually forgotten, the thermostat plays an essential duty in the effectiveness of a/c systems. HVAC experts. This small tool acts as the main nerve center, regulating temperature level setups and making certain suitable convenience within a space. By accurately noticing the ambient temperature, the thermostat communicates with the air, ventilation, and home heating conditioning devices to keep the preferred environment




A reliable thermostat lessens power usage by turning on the HVAC system just when required, therefore protecting against excessive heating or cooling. Modern smart and programmable thermostats improve this performance further by enabling customers to set schedules and remotely adjust settings, adjusting to day-to-day regimens.


The placement of the thermostat is vital; inappropriate area can lead to imprecise temperature level analyses, resulting in inefficient procedure. Generally, a well-functioning thermostat not only enhances convenience yet likewise contributes substantially to energy savings and the longevity of the a/c system.


Comprehending the Value of Air Filters



Air filters serve an important feature in cooling and heating systems by ensuring that the air flowing within an area stays clean and healthy and balanced. These filters trap dirt, irritants, and various other pollutants, preventing them from being recirculated throughout the environment. By catching these fragments, air filters add to improved interior air high quality, which can substantially profit occupants' health and wellness, particularly those with allergies or breathing problems.


In addition, maintaining tidy air filters enhances the effectiveness of heating and cooling systems. Clogged filters can restrict airflow, causing the system to function more difficult to keep preferred temperatures, leading to boosted energy usage and higher utility costs. Regularly changing or cleaning filters is a crucial upkeep step that can lengthen the lifespan of cooling and heating devices. Ultimately, understanding the importance of air filters allows homeowners and building managers to take aggressive steps to assure a well-functioning, efficient a/c system that advertises a comfy and secure indoor setting.

The Performance of the Furnace and Heatpump



Heating systems and heat pumps are critical parts of a/c systems, responsible for giving warmth throughout colder months. Heaters operate by heating air via combustion or electrical resistance, then dispersing it throughout the home by means of ducts. They generally use quick heating and can be fueled by gas, electricity, or oil, depending upon the system kind.


Conversely, heatpump move warm instead than create it. They remove heat from the outside air or ground, even in low temperatures, and transfer it inside your home. HVAC experts. This double capability permits warmth pumps to additionally provide cooling in warmer months, making them versatile options for year-round climate control


Both systems require proper maintenance to guarantee efficiency and longevity. While furnaces master extreme cold, heatpump can be helpful in modest environments. Comprehending their unique capabilities help house owners in selecting the most ideal alternative for their home heating requires.

Kinds Of Air Conditioners



While different factors affect the option of air conditioning systems, recognizing the different kinds offered is important for property owners and structure managers alike. Central air conditioning conditioners are developed to cool down entire homes or buildings, making use of a network of ducts for air movement. Window devices use a more localized option, perfect for little spaces or solitary rooms. Mobile a/c supply adaptability, permitting users to relocate the system as needed. Ductless mini-split systems are another choice, incorporating the effectiveness of main systems with the convenience of zoning, as they need no ductwork. Ultimately, geothermal systems harness the earth's temperature level for energy-efficient air conditioning. Each type includes distinctive advantages, making informed options essential for efficient climate control.

Performance Ratings Explained



Recognizing effectiveness ratings is vital for picking the right a/c unit, as these metrics give understanding into the system's efficiency and power usage. One of the most common ranking for air conditioning unit is the Seasonal Energy Efficiency Ratio (SEER), which determines the cooling result throughout a common air conditioning period separated by the total electric energy input. A greater SEER shows better efficiency. Furthermore, the Power Performance Proportion (EER) is utilized for measuring performance under certain problems. An additional important metric is the Energy Star accreditation, which symbolizes that a device fulfills rigorous power performance standards. By evaluating these ratings, consumers can make informed choices that not only optimize comfort but likewise minimize power expenses and environmental effect.

Routine Upkeep Practices to Enhance Performance



Normal upkeep practices are crucial for guaranteeing peak efficiency of cooling and heating systems. These practices consist of routine assessments, cleansing, and necessary repair work to maintain the system running successfully. Frequently transforming air filters is essential, as clogged filters can obstruct air flow and minimize effectiveness. In enhancement, specialists ought to inspect and tidy evaporator and condenser coils to stop overheating and energy waste.


Annual expert assessments are additionally advised, as experienced technicians can identify potential issues prior to they escalate. Lubricating moving components decreases wear and tear, adding to a much longer life-span for the system. In addition, making certain that the thermostat functions correctly aids in maintaining optimal temperature control.

How Frequently Should I Replace My Thermostat?



Thermostats must normally be changed every 5 to one decade, relying on use and innovation innovations. Normal checks are suggested to assure peak efficiency, particularly if experiencing inconsistent temperature control or boosted energy expenses.


What Size Air Filter Is Best for My HVAC System?



The very best dimension air filter for a HVAC system differs by system style. Usually, it's important to speak with the owner's guidebook or examine the existing filter dimensions to guarantee peak efficiency and air high quality.


Can I Install a Heat Pump Myself?



Mounting a heatpump separately is possible for knowledgeable people, however it requires expertise of electric systems and local codes. Hiring a specialist is suggested to guarantee correct setup and perfect system efficiency.


Exactly how Do I Know if My Ductwork Is Efficient?



To establish ductwork performance, one need to inspect for leaks, procedure airflow at vents, evaluate insulation top quality, and review temperature level differences in between supply and return air ducts. Specialist evaluations can provide detailed insights right into overall efficiency.


What Are Signs My Cooling And Heating Requirements Immediate Upkeep?



Signs that a HVAC system needs prompt maintenance consist of uncommon noises, irregular this contact form temperature levels, enhanced power bills, unpleasant smells, and constant cycling. Attending to these concerns quickly can prevent additional damages and warranty peak system efficiency.
